Rosie Figueroa Killed in DUI Crash on Davis Road in Salinas
Rosie Figueroa ID’d as Woman Killed in Salinas Car Accident on Davis Road

Salinas, California (December 22, 2019) – Authorities have identified the woman who was killed Friday night in an alleged DUI crash in Salinas as Rosie Figueroa, 38.
The deadly crash happened Friday, December 20 on Davis Road.
According to the California Highway Patrol, Figueroa was driving a 2012 Toyota Camry northbound on Davis Road when for an unknown reason, the Camry was hit from the back by a 2015 Mazda 6 driven by Jacques Clarke, 18.
The force of the impact caused the Camry to spin out of control and struck a large tree before it overturned.
Figueroa was declared deceased at the scene and her female passenger was transported to Natividad Hospital with major injuries.
Jacques Clarke Arrested Following Fatal Crash in Salinas
Authorities said Clarke was booked into the Monterey County Jail for DUI causing great bodily and vehicular manslaughter while intoxicated. His bail was set at $200,000.
The accident remains under investigation.
